Show Notes

On the latest episode of The Staffing Show, Tim Glennie, managing partner and co-founder of BridgeView, shares his experience with co-creating a firm that blends consulting and IT staffing services. He talks about the importance of getting sustained, intentional feedback from clients as well as being a partner through each stage of a client’s journey. He also shares insights on the emergence of “Zoom cities” and their impact on how workers approach and assess their quality of life as well as compensation.
